Best unarmed weapons?
So, like anyone who decided to go the unarmed route, I've been extremely disappointed in the weapon variety. Near as I can tell, boxing gloves are the worst despite being rare, knuckles are a minor step up and relatively common, and powerfists/deathclaw gauntlets are both at the tippy top and insanely rare. To add to the disappointment, powerfists are better than gauntlets while being nearly identical to begin with.

Is there anything else? Anything at all? Or is it really a complete dead end so early on?

The gauntlet you get from killing Swan, forgot the name, is very good. Also you get a Deathclaw gauntlet from a quest in the museum of witchcraft if you bring the egg back to the nest and (before putting the egg in the nest) look at the area next to the nest, there lies one gauntlet

I went Unarmed route
I picked the power first from Swan
I used full combat(fully modded) armor + soldier fatigues(think that's the name but i could be wrong) and maxed out STR + took the unarmed + big leagues perk.
I took the defensive perks in Endurance and the Lone wanderer perk in Charisma.
And lastly I leveled Agility and took the perk that gives you a chance for more critical hits.

I went and attacked everything, nearly everything got 1 hitted (aside from Deathclaws/PA) if not 3 hits.

Long Story Short, Unarmed is very strong but I wouldnt recommend it for very early gameplay. I would build the early gameplay with the perks needing for unarmed while using Guns to kill until you get the power first and decent armor to survive the bullets when you are going close to kill the npcs.

EDIT: Also there are 2 Legendary Quaranted Unarmed weapons (1 is from Swan[Power First] and the second is from the Deathclaw near the Museum of Witchcraft)
